What is BS EN IEC 60667-3-1 about?
This International Standard is one of a series which deals with vulcanized fibre sheets for electrical purposes.
BS EN IEC 60667-3-1 is the third part in a multi-series gives requirements for vulcanized fibre sheets for electrical purposes. Materials made by combining with an adhesive several thicknesses of vulcanized fibre are not covered by this BS EN IEC 60667-3-1 .
Materials that conform to this specification meet established levels of performance. However, the selection of a material by a user for a specific application is based on the actual requirements necessary for adequate performance in that application and not based on this specification alone.

Why should you use BS EN IEC 60667-3-1 ?
Vulcanized fibres are produced by laminating plies of 100% cellulose paper after saturation phases in zinc chloride and acid baths. This manufacturing process gives this insulating material superior mechanical, insulating and electrical characteristics.
BS EN IEC 60667-3 covers requirements for vulcanized fibre sheets based on properties such as thickness, apparent density, specific gravity, tensile strength, flexural strength, arc resistance, water absorption, ash content, moisture content and shrinkage.
